
Trawl Hz's work involves the capturing of field recordings within environments that hold everyday or exceptional sonic qualities. Forging raw with processed recordings, he produces real and imagined sound universes, together with aural docu-poems and dense electronic music. Binaural sound and multi-speaker arrays are utilised as conduits for these layered sonic narratives. Trawl Hz has received awards from The Danish Arts Council, Arts Council England, British Council, PRS Foundation For New Music, Koda Kultur, Nordisk Kulturfond and the Royal Norwegian Embassy.
Rooted in sound system culture, Trawl Hz has woven electronic music and sound into his life since 1987.
A working DJ until the early 2000s, his ongoing passion for electronic music has kept him connected to the underground scene to this day. He has been a part of pioneering entities such as Mighty Force Records, which released the first two Aphex Twin 12s, and DJ'd alongside key figures in the London and European club scenes such as Fabio, Colin Faver, DJ Bone, Luke Slater, Jega and Cristian Vogel to name but a few.

The beating path, his curiosity for new sonic adventures and an inner need to reconnect with his ancestry, led him to the African continent where he travelled around Southern Africa capturing field recordings and collaborating with local musicians, which in turn led to the establishment of his ultra-sporadic record label District Six Records. Artists include Metamatics, Anthony Manning, William Rusere, Plaid, Deepart, Burnt Friedman, Gaby Kerpel, Afrikan Sciences, Demons and Goodiepal

This period was the catalyst for new directions as sound artist and location sound recordist for the moving image, radio and new media. Following his studies at the National Film & television School, Trawl Hz has gone on to build a portfolio that includes an array of location and post production assignments incorporating documentary, fiction, music, performance and gallery installations. Highlights include working as sound recordist and designer for BBC Radio Three and Four drama commissions, collaborating with Warp Records stalwarts Plaid, travelling across the Sahara and recording Tamasheq freedom fighters turned musicians, Tinariwen, and capturing sounds in the Black Mountains for John Cale.

Trawl Hz has lectured at The London College Of Communication UAL, and holds workshops on creative field recording and sonic narratives.
